What Makes a Reliable Online Casino?

A trustworthy operator normally displays its licensing information clearly and explains how player funds, personal data, and game outcomes are protected. Independent testing agencies may audit random number generators, while secure encryption helps reduce the risk of unauthorised access. Players should also be able to read the terms for bonuses, withdrawals, identity checks, and account closure before depositing.

Reputation is another important factor. A casino with a long operating history, responsive support, and consistent payment performance is generally easier to evaluate than a brand with limited information. Reviews can provide useful clues, but they should be compared across several sources because individual experiences may not reflect the complete picture.

Bonuses, Wagering Requirements, and Real Value

Welcome offers and ongoing promotions can increase entertainment value, but the headline amount is only one part of the deal. A bonus may require players to wager several times before winnings become withdrawable. Other conditions can include maximum bet rules, game contribution percentages, expiry dates, restricted payment methods, and maximum cash-out limits.

Before accepting an offer, read the full promotional terms and calculate whether the conditions suit your budget and preferred games. For example, a slot may contribute fully toward wagering, while a table game may contribute only a small percentage. A promotion with a lower advertised value but clearer conditions may be more useful than a large offer with demanding restrictions.

  • Check the minimum deposit and eligible payment methods.
  • Review the wagering multiplier and qualifying game categories.
  • Confirm the promotion’s expiry date and maximum bet rule.
  • Look for maximum winnings, withdrawal, and cash-out conditions.
  • Never deposit more than you can comfortably afford to lose.

Understanding Return to Player and Volatility

Return to player, commonly called RTP, is a long-term theoretical percentage indicating how much a game may return over a very large number of rounds. It is not a promise for a single session. Volatility describes how frequently and how significantly a game tends to pay. Low-volatility titles may offer smaller, more regular wins, while high-volatility games can produce longer losing periods alongside occasional larger payouts.

These figures are useful for comparing games, but they do not remove chance. A carefully selected RTP or volatility level cannot guarantee a result, so a fixed spending limit remains more important than any statistic.

Mobile Casino Gaming and Account Security

Mobile casino platforms have become central to the modern iGaming experience. A well-designed mobile site or application should load quickly, display games clearly, and support secure deposits, withdrawals, and account controls. Players should download applications only from official sources and avoid unfamiliar files or links shared through unsolicited messages.

Security habits also matter. Use a unique password, enable two-factor authentication where available, keep devices updated, and avoid accessing financial accounts through unsecured public networks. Never share login codes with another person, even if a message appears to come from customer support. Legitimate operators will not request a complete password or ask players to bypass normal verification procedures.

Responsible Gambling Should Come First

Gambling should remain a form of entertainment, not a method of earning income or recovering financial losses. Set a budget and time limit before playing, keep gambling separate from essential household spending, and take regular breaks. Chasing losses, hiding activity, borrowing money, or feeling unable to stop are warning signs that additional support may be needed.

Many licensed casinos provide deposit limits, loss limits, reality checks, time-outs, and self-exclusion tools. These features are most effective when activated before a problem develops. Players who feel gambling is becoming difficult to control should contact a recognised support organisation or a qualified professional in their region.
